Calgary food hall ordered to close by AHS due to ‘pest activity’

A Calgary food hall says it has been closed for the time being due to “pest activity” identified by Alberta Health Services (AHS).

First Street Market, located at 1327 First St. S.W. in Victoria Park, was closed effective Nov. 28, according to a closure order issued by AHS.

The closure order says it is in effect for all vendors in the food hall.

The closure came after an “investigation identified pest activity in the market,” a First Street Market spokesperson told CBC News in an emailed statement.

The closure order will remain until AHS lifts it.

“Commercial grade sanitation is being completed across all surfaces, food storage areas, and preparation facilities,” the statement from First Street Market reads.

“Treatment and follow up inspections are underway, and we will only reopen once AHS confirms that it is safe to do so.”

Actually Pretty Good serves pizza at the food market. General manager Chris Gale told CBC News in an emailed statement that “in a multi-vendor food market, health concerns at one vendor’s operation can quickly impact others, so vigilance is essential.”

First Street Market first opened in 2021.
